what is the meaning of 'underemployment'? In which economic sector underemployment conditions more prevalent ? why is it so ? explain two reasons . |
Answer» Underemployment is a measure of employment and labor UTILIZATION in the economy that looks at how WELL the labor force is being used in terms of skills, experience, and availability to work. It refers to a situation in which individuals are forced to work in low-paying or low-skill jobs.The members work on the field as they are not engaged in any other economic activity. THEREFORE, even if they will not work, the production of the land will not be affected. This underempolyment condition is more prelevant in Primary sector,because more jobs are not available in secondary and tertiary sectors.The members work on the field as they are not engaged in any other economic activity. Therefore, even if they will not work, the production of the land will not be affected. This results in underemployment.
